Effect of integrated nutrient management on growth and yield of irrigated linseed (Linum usitatissimum L.)

Author(s):
Hemraj Kumawat, AS Karle, Harish Giri Goswami, Ashish Raja Jangid and Dhiraj Madhav Kadam
Abstract:
A field experiment was conducted during rabi season of 2020-21 at Experimental Farm, Oilseeds Research Station, Latur to determine the effect of integrated nutrient management (INM) on growth and yield of linseed on vertisols soil order. The experiment was laid out Randomized Block Design with seven treatments, replicated thrice. The result of the study revealed that significantly higher growth attributes viz. plant height, no. of branches per plant, total dry matter per plant at 30, 45, 60, 75, 90 DAS and at harvest, plant spread at 45, 60, 75, 90 DAS and at harvest, and mean days required for 50 per cent flowering and yield attributes like no. of capsules per plant (85.96), weight of capsule per plant (5.48g), no. of seed per capsules (9.25), weight of seed per plant (3.68g), test weight (9.24g), seed yield (1757 kg ha-1), straw yield (2690 kg ha-1), biological yield (4447 kg/ha) and harvest index (39.50%) was observed with the application of RDNPS + FYM @ 5 t ha-1 + Vermicompost @ 2.5 t ha-1 + ZnSO4 @ 20 kg ha-1 (T6).
